SqueezeNetwork

SqueezeNetwork is an always-on service that provides access to Internet Radio, alarm clock, natural sounds, news feeds and more, even when your computer is off.

Your Squeezebox connects to SqueezeNetwork using your broadband Internet connection. When your Squeezebox is connected to SqueezeNetwork, it’s not connected to your SlimServer computer.

To connect to SqueezeNetwork, press the left button until SQUEEZEBOX SETUP

or SQUEEZEBOX HOME are displayed on the screen. Then use the DOWN button to scroll to SQUEEZENETWORK and press RIGHT.

The fi rst time you connect to SqueezeNetwork, you’ll be asked to choose a language

and time zone. You’ll then be provided with a Personal Identifi cation Number (PIN) for your Squeezebox.

Visit http://www.squeezenetwork.com/ with your web browser to create an account on SqueezeNetwork and enter your PIN to register. From that web site you can add favorites to your SqueezeNetwork account, add and modify your favorite radio stations, RSS News feeds and more.

If you ever need to fi nd your PIN again later, connect to SqueezeNetwork with your remote and scroll DOWN to SETTINGS, press RIGHT, then scroll to SQUEEZEBOX PIN and press RIGHT again.

To switch back to your SlimServer from SqueezeNetwork, press LEFT until you see SQUEEZENETWORK on the top line of the display, then scroll to LOG OFF, then press

RIGHT.

Tip: “Where am I?” Press LEFT repeatedly until you get to the top most menu. If you are connected to SqueezeNetwork, you’ll see SqueezeNetwork on the top line. If you are connected to your SlimServer computer, you’ll see Squeezebox Home.

Special Features

Squeezebox has a beautiful high-resolution vacuum fl uorescent display. In addition to displaying the name of the track or internet radio station you’re currently listening to, you can tell Squeezebox to show you dynamic content via RSS feeds, gorgeous graphic music visualizers, as well as a variety of screensavers, games and more.

There are a wide range of settings to let you customize your Squeezebox to your liking. Explore! You won’t be sorry. Here are a few to get you started.

Alarm Clock

Squeezebox has a built-in alarm clock feature with eight alarms—one for each day of the week and another that goes off every day at the same time.

To set the alarms using the remote control:

1.Press the left arrow until you see SQUEEZEBOX HOME or SQUEEZENETWORK on the top line of the display. Scroll down until you see SETTINGS and press the RIGHT arrow.

2.Scroll down until you see ALARM CLOCK then press the right arrow.

3.To set an alarm that goes off every day:

Press RIGHT when displaying SET ALARM TIME to enter the alarm time.

Use the arrow keys to move and set the time. Press LEFT when you’ve set the time.

Press DOWN to see Alarm Playlist, then press right. Choose from this list the playlist that you’d like to hear when the alarm goes off. Press left once you’ve chosen your playlist.

Press DOWN to see ALARM VOLUME, then press RIGHT. Use the UP and DOWN buttons to adjust the volume for the alarm. Press RIGHT when you’ve fi nished.

Press DOWN to see ALARM CLOCK OFF. Press right to turn on the alarm. Press RIGHT again to turn it off.
